Early Level (age 3 to Primary 1) Expressive Arts Learning Activities

These pages will look to support learning in Expressive Arts subjects for children working at Early Level or aged 3 to Primary 1. These activities cover participation in performances and presentations, Art and design, Dance, Drama and Music.

LOST have created a set of resources we have called Literacy Out of the Box.  The resources are suggestions for tasks across all 8 curricular areas which link to the reading of a particular story.  Click on Introduction to Literacy Out of the Box Resources to find out more and, where possible, find links to video and audio readings.  You do not need to know the stories to enjoy most of the activities.  Below, you will find links to Expressive Arts learning activities related to each book which are suitable for learners at Early Level.
